What is the penalty for carrying a concealed firearm without a permit in Louisiana?

A fine of up to $100

Imprisonment for up to 2 years

A fine and community service

Imprisonment for up to 6 months

In Louisiana, the penalty for carrying a concealed firearm without a permit is imprisonment for up to 6 months. This is in accordance with Louisiana gun laws which require individuals to have a permit to carry a concealed firearm legally. Carrying a concealed firearm without the proper permit is considered a serious offense, leading to potential imprisonment as a consequence. It is crucial to abide by the state's regulations regarding firearms to avoid legal consequences.
